Step 3: Introduce a dog toothpaste and toothbrush (despite the fact that a clean nylon can serve right here also) and just let your dog lick away — still no brushing. Important note: DO NOT use human toothpaste. Substances like fluoride which discover their way into several toothpaste brands are toxic to animals The CVMA is adamant that pet owners seek out VOHC authorized toothpaste only. As well several pet items on the market place are devoid of a VOHC rating and some of the ingredients used aren't undertaking dogs any favours.

Board-certified veterinary dentist Dr Fraser Hale asserts that canine genetics play a main role in the prevalence of serious periodontal illnesses in dogs but, just like humans, normal trips to the dentist from an early age can aid assuage that. Veterinary removal of misshapen or crowded teeth can have a massive impact on oral wellness - right after that, the greatest course of action is quite a lot the very same as it is for us: strict adherence to a everyday brushing routine. Unless your dog is specifically gifted, they are likely going to need to have some help from their human in this arena.

The third message for this age group is to instruct caregivers to clean their babies' gums day-to-day. Right after feedings, the caregiver ought to use a clean, damp washcloth, finger cot or gauze square to gently wipe baby's gums and tongue. If the child has teeth ahead of six months, be certain to clean them too.

Nevertheless, it is not just its efficacy in preventing tooth decay which has put fluoride in the spotlight. If men and women are exposed to as well a lot, it can lead to permanently brown-stained teeth a condition identified as fluorosis. Kids are specifically vulnerable to these marks, which is why it is suggested that they only use a quite little quantity of toothpaste when brushing their teeth.
